Conditions at Ligia in November
November: Serious Swell Returns
November delivers the first genuinely consistent surf of the season. Average height climbs to 0.7m (2-3ft / 0.6-0.9m), period to 5.6s and ideal wind reaches 34%. The swell direction balance shifts in Ligia's favor: SW leads at 15.0%, SSW at 11.9%, S at 11.3% and WSW at 8.8%, with NW and WNW around but more secondary. This is great news for a WSW-facing beach, because the southerly and southwesterly component has plenty of open Ionian fetch. The wind regime is strongly ENE/E at 13.5% and 14.8%, with NE at 9.5%, making offshore conditions common and clean. Rain falls more steadily at 4.67 mm/day and air temps drop to 15.2°C, while the sea remains a comfy 19.7°C. November is arguably one of the best months to score Ligia with actual push.
